Malayalam actor Prithviraj Sukumaran is taking legal action against a YouTube channel for publishing a ‘defamatory’ story against him.

Malayalam actor Prithviraj Sukumaran on Thursday lashed out at a YouTube channel for making “false and malicious” allegations against him. In a lengthy Instagram post, the Kaduva star reacted strongly to claims that he was making “promotional films” and paid them Rs 25 crore. Enforcement Directorate (ED).

According to a report in India Today.in, the YouTube channel in question published a news story on May 11 alleging that Prithviraj Sukumaran had received funds from some sources in the Middle East that were being probed by the Enforcement Directorate.

Prithviraj Sukumaran took to his Instagram account to condemn these allegations. Sharing his statement, the actor wrote, “I usually ignore these because words like “ethical journalism” are becoming increasingly redundant in the times we live in. But there is a limit to propagating outright lies in the name of “news”. This is a fight I want to see till the end. Filing civil and criminal defamation suits. PS: For those of you still wondering… No, I haven’t paid any fine.”

What did Prithviraj Sukumaran write in his statement

It has come to my notice that a YouTube channel named Marunadanamalayali has published a false and defamatory story alleging that I have paid a fine of Rs. 25,00,00,000/- as per the proceedings initiated by the Enforcement Directorate and making promotional films. The allegations are devoid of any truth, are malicious and defamatory. I am initiating legal action for the false and defamatory allegations leveled against me. I hereby request all responsible media channels to ensure that further reporting on the allegations is done only after verification and corroboration of facts.
